About This Item

No place noted,, 2015. Reprint. Hardback. . Fine.. 8vo. pp 213. Original publisher's illustrated laminated boards. Issued without dust jacket. This true, documented chronicle is the intimate, day-to-day record of a woman who survived the nightmare of Auschwitz and Birkenau. ISBN: 9781258006365

Reprint
Any printing of a book which follows the original edition. By definition, a reprint is not a first edition.
